Transaction 594638419dde34be8ff71c46f32207db8dbe0a441be997d9225f485829eaf66b

1 Input
2 Outputs
  • 594638419dde34be8ff71c46f32207db8dbe0a441be997d9225f485829eaf66b:0
  • value  195166686
    address  3FbreRi3jVd7RgGPXPnTQYgnQSSp7QivJJ
  • 594638419dde34be8ff71c46f32207db8dbe0a441be997d9225f485829eaf66b:1
  • value  1000000
    address  143zGUgW3yjLD8V2TVqbheGGnSKDAS9a29